Low-key post-Christmas friendly in Ferrycarrig this afternoon against the Wexford GAA team which included former Youths players such as Ricky Fox, Ben Brosnan, Shane Sinnott, Eric Bradley, Kevin Rowe, and Lee Chin who is ex-Waterford. First outing for new manager Shane Keegan, who is impressively animated on the sideline, and which ended 3-1 for the GAA team.
Wexford Youths squad may give some indication as to who will be with us next year had thirteen on the programme as follows, although Karl Keogh at least was a no-show.
